Los Angeles Galaxy cruise to comfortable win over Chivas USA

LA Galaxy earn their first win of the new MLS season, comfortably beating Chivas USA 3-0 at the Stubhub Centre this evening.

Los Angeles Galaxy have cruised to a comfortable 3-0 win over Chivas USA in their MLS encounter this evening.

The visitors were the first to threaten when Robbie Keane played the ball through to Marcelo Sarvas, who chipped it over the keeper but couldn't steer it on target.

Keane came close himself 10 minutes before the break, latching on to Landon Donovan's pass before fizzing an effort narrowly wide of the post.

The Republic of Ireland striker wouldn't have to wait much longer for a goal, however, opening the scoring two minutes later when he slotted a rebound home after Dan Gargan's header caught Dan Kennedy off guard.

It was 2-0 shortly afterwards as the Galaxy completed a two-goal salvo in six minutes at the end of the first half when Stefan Ishizaki produced a sublime chip over the keeper to double his side's lead.

Keane almost had a second for the night soon after the restart when he beat the keeper with an effort, but Carlos Bocanegra was on hand to clear the ball off the line.

It was 3-0 in the 56th minute, however, as Keane and Donovan combined to set up Baggio Husidic for a goal that sealed the points for Los Angeles.

Chivas finally made Brian Perk work for the first time in the 81st minute, but the Galaxy keeper made a comfortable save to ensure a clean sheet to go along with the victory.
